Roadmap for Transition from Analogue to Digital Terrestrial Television Broadcasting and Mobile Television in Asia and the Pacific

Project No 9RAS12042
Title Roadmap for Transition from Analogue to Digital Terrestrial Television Broadcasting and Mobile Television in Asia and the Pacific
Description

The broadcasting industry is undergoing major transformation in the converged environment. The technologies driving the transmission, production and archiving are in the process of transitioning from analogue to digital creating new opportunities while posing new challenges.
Analogue TV is on the verge of obsolescence in most developed countries. Most developing and least developed countries however are in early stages of this significant technology transition. Many countries require technical support to develop their plans for such transition. The introduction of the digital broadcasting was endorsed by the region as one of the Regional Initiatives for Asia-Pacific by the World Telecommunication Development Conference (WTDC-10, Hyderabad, India, 24 May – 4 June 2010)
The objective of this project is to assist countries in Asia and the Pacific region in smooth transition from analogue to digital terrestrial television broadcasting with the following:

  • Policy and regulatory framework for digital terrestrial television broadcasting through adaptation of comprehensive guideline developed by BDT for transition from analogue to digital broadcasting;
  • Digital Broadcasting Master Plan for transition from analogue to digital terrestrial television broadcasting for selected countries;
  • Enhanced skills of concerned experts on the digital broadcasting master plan for the transition and technologies including interactive multimedia services, Mobile TV, and IPTV.

Achievements

8 countries in Asia Pacific (Indonesia, Fiji, Papua New Guinea, Philippines, Thailand, Laos, Myanmar, and Timor Leste) have received ITU assistance in developing the roadmap report on digital broadcasting transition.

Organized ITU-ABU-AIBD Regional Workshop on Digital Broadcasting Implementaton: 4-5 March 2013,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. 180 participants from 30 countries were trained.
